• Question: We have been told that the universe is continually expanding but at some point its going to start shrinking.why is this?

      it ain’t necessarily so.
      evidence at the moment points to it expanding forever, at the moment the expansion is accelerating, but the acceleration is thought to be decreasing. this points to the conclusion that the force doing the accelerating is very nearly balanced by the force of gravity – this is what slows it down. we don’t yet know the origin of the accelerating force. people have started to call this “dark energy”
